Crafting Precise Prompts for Pharma Medical Animation Creation

In the rapidly evolving field of pharmaceutical marketing and education, medical animations have become an essential tool. They help visualize complex biological processes, drug mechanisms, and medical procedures in an engaging and understandable way. To produce high-quality animations that meet specific needs, crafting precise prompts is crucial for effective communication with animation creators or AI tools.

The Importance of Clear and Detailed Prompts

Clear prompts ensure that the animation accurately represents the intended concept. Vague or ambiguous instructions can lead to misinterpretations, resulting in animations that do not meet educational or marketing goals. Precise prompts save time, reduce revisions, and enhance the overall quality of the final product.

Key Elements of an Effective Prompt

  • Objective: Clearly state what the animation should demonstrate or explain.
  • Target Audience: Define who will view the animation (e.g., medical professionals, patients, students).
  • Scope and Detail: Specify the level of detail required, from high-level overviews to detailed molecular interactions.
  • Visual Style: Describe preferred styles, such as realistic, schematic, or stylized.
  • Color Scheme: Indicate any color preferences or branding requirements.
  • Duration: Provide the desired length of the animation.
  • Key Scenes or Concepts: Outline specific scenes or concepts that must be included.

Tips for Crafting Effective Prompts

To maximize the quality of medical animations, consider the following tips:

  • Be Specific: Use precise language and avoid vague descriptions.
  • Use Visual References: Include sketches, images, or links to examples when possible.
  • Prioritize Information: Highlight the most critical aspects to ensure they are emphasized.
  • Iterate and Communicate: Provide feedback and refine prompts based on initial drafts.
  • Understand Technical Limitations: Be aware of what is feasible within the animation tools or resources.

Examples of Well-Crafted Prompts

Example 1: “Create a 30-second animation illustrating the mechanism of action of a new anticoagulant drug. The style should be semi-realistic with a blue and white color palette. Focus on how the drug inhibits clot formation at the molecular level, targeting specific enzymes.”

Example 2: “Develop a schematic animation showing the process of vaccine delivery via intramuscular injection, highlighting the entry of the vaccine into muscle tissue and the subsequent immune response. The target audience is medical students, so include detailed molecular interactions.”
